Steve ..... For daytime shots I typically run NN and Dfine once before resizing the image and I sharpen the image twice, once in the native file size and a second time after the image has been resized.

For night images I typically do the same as listed above but run NN a second time after the image has been resized and I may or may not do sharpening of the image after its resized. You may end up with over-sharpened results.
